This is not the first time I have visited The Charles Dickens and on both occasions the food has been lovely. However, today it took almost 3 hours to be served a 2 course meal. We had to ask more than once for a dessert menu and the bill took over 20 minutes and 3 requests to arrive. The restaurant was not overly busy and staff often looked in to the area where we were seated - with no food or with empty plates in front of us - and didn't come over. The service was poor and the two star rating is due to this and not the food which was plentiful and tasty.

First time visit and I'm kicking myself... Been missing out on a quality spot in Broadstairs. Price about normal not cheap but not OTT. Location amazing. Tasty starters (calamari was probs on the ever so slightly bland side) but the tiger prawns in Nduja butter were magnificent. Very well priced and generous seafood platter and a top notch Sunday roast. Washed down with a Beavertown Neck Oil.
